Technical Specifications

Side-by-side comparison of G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U and G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U

NVIDIA

G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U

The G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in May 18 2023. It features the Ada Lovelace architecture. The core clock ranges from 2310 MHz to 2535 MHz. It has 4352 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 160W. Manufactured using 5 nm process technology. It features 34 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 17,400 points. Launch price was $399.

NVIDIA

G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U

The G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in April 16 2025. It features the Blackwell 2.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 2407 MHz to 2572 MHz. It has 4608 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 180W. Manufactured using 5 nm process technology. It features 36 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 23,095 points. Launch price was $379.

Graphics Performance

In G3D Mark, the G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U scores 17,400 versus the G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U's 23,095 — the G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U leads by 32.7%. The G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U is built on Ada Lovelace while the G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U uses Blackwell 2.0, both on a 5 nm process. Shader units: 4,352 (G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U) vs 4,608 (G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U). Raw compute: 22.06 TFLOPS (G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U) vs 23.7 TFLOPS (G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U). Boost clocks: 2535 MHz vs 2572 MHz. Ray tracing: 34 RT cores (G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U) vs 36 (G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U) with 136 Tensor cores vs 144.

Advanced Features (DLSS/FSR)

Both cards support Frame Generation, but the G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U is on a newer tier with DLSS 4 Multi Frame Generation, while the G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U tops out at DLSS 3.5 + Frame Generation.The G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U supports the newer DLSS 4 Super Resolution, whereas the G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U is capped at DLSS 3.5 Super Resolution.

Video Memory (VRAM)

The G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U comes with 8 GB of VRAM, while the G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U has 12 GB. The G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U offers 50% more capacity, crucial for higher resolutions and texture-heavy games. Memory bandwidth: 256 GB/s (G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U) vs 672 GB/s (G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U) — a 162.5% advantage for the G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U. Bus width: 128-bit vs 192-bit.

Media & Encoding

Hardware encoder: NVENC (8th Gen) (G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U) vs NVENC (9th Gen) (G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U). Decoder: NVDEC (5th Gen) vs NVDEC (6th Gen). Supported codecs: H.264,HEVC,AV1,VP9 (GeForce RTX 4060 Laptop GPU) vs H.264,HEVC,AV1,VP9 (GeForce RTX 5070 Ti Laptop GPU).
